WebMar 25, 2024 · The Flemish Primitives is the common name of Early Netherlandish painters. These highly talented individuals were active during the Burgundian and Habsburg rule in the Low Countries in the 15th and 16th centuries. Most of them were Flemish artists who lived and worked in modern-day Belgium. Cities like Bruges, Ghent, and Brussels, … WebAfter 1550, the Flemish and Dutch painters begin to show more interest in nature and in beauty an sich, leading to a style that incorporates Renaissance elements, but remains very far from the elegant lightness of Italian Renaissance art, and directly leads to the themes of the great Flemish and Dutch Baroque painters: landscapes, still lifes ...
